[Android] Medialibrary: publish clearDatabase method
Geoffrey Métais
git at videolan.org
Fri Nov 15 17:51:11 CET 2019
vlc-android | branch: 3.2.x | Geoffrey Métais <geoffrey.metais at gmail.com> | Fri Nov 15 15:26:30 2019 +0100| [5f456298925ce1b61d982b7838ff42dc5fdc7252] | committer: Geoffrey Métais
Medialibrary: publish clearDatabase method
(cherry picked from commit f7e12af9aebc19d0ccc36df05e233bcfff0a3461)
> https://code.videolan.org/videolan/vlc-android/commit/5f456298925ce1b61d982b7838ff42dc5fdc7252
---
.../src/org/videolan/medialibrary/interfaces/AbstractMedialibrary.java | 1 +
medialibrary/src/org/videolan/medialibrary/stubs/StubMedialibrary.java | 3 +++
2 files changed, 4 insertions(+)
diff --git a/medialibrary/src/org/videolan/medialibrary/interfaces/AbstractMedialibrary.java b/medialibrary/src/org/videolan/medialibrary/interfaces/AbstractMedialibrary.java
index b4d208a5f..7ceef89db 100644
--- a/medialibrary/src/org/videolan/medialibrary/interfaces/AbstractMedialibrary.java
+++ b/medialibrary/src/org/videolan/medialibrary/interfaces/AbstractMedialibrary.java
@@ -655,6 +655,7 @@ abstract public class AbstractMedialibrary {
abstract public AbstractMediaWrapper[] lastMediaPlayed();
abstract public AbstractMediaWrapper[] lastStreamsPlayed();
abstract public boolean clearHistory();
+ abstract public void clearDatabase(boolean restorePlaylist);
abstract public boolean addToHistory(String mrl, String title);
abstract public AbstractMediaWrapper getMedia(long id);
abstract public AbstractMediaWrapper getMedia(Uri uri);
diff --git a/medialibrary/src/org/videolan/medialibrary/stubs/StubMedialibrary.java b/medialibrary/src/org/videolan/medialibrary/stubs/StubMedialibrary.java
index 8e746a0f3..656e5f161 100644
--- a/medialibrary/src/org/videolan/medialibrary/stubs/StubMedialibrary.java
+++ b/medialibrary/src/org/videolan/medialibrary/stubs/StubMedialibrary.java
@@ -330,6 +330,9 @@ public class StubMedialibrary extends AbstractMedialibrary {
return true;
}
+ @Override
+ public void clearDatabase(boolean restorePlaylist) {}
+
//TODO what if two files have the same name ??
// TODO what happens in case of false return
public boolean addToHistory(String mrl, String title) {
More information about the Android
mailing list